Recognizing Risk Factors:

Several risk factors add to the susceptibility of both drivers and passengers in ride-hailing vehicles. The inherent nature of the platform, which connects strangers in close quarters, increases the likelihood for dangerous situations. Aspects such as nighttime trips, passengers under the influence, lack of adequate background checks, and the lack of security measures within vehicles can further aggravate the risks. It is essential to acknowledge these factors and implement proactive steps to reduce them.

Improved Safety Measures:

Rideshare companies have a responsibility to ensure the safety of their drivers and passengers. They should regularly review and enhance safety protocols to address sexual assault and violence. Some important precautionary steps include:

a) Thorough background checks: Comprehensive background checks should be performed on those providing the rides to uncover any previous records or red flags.

b) Identity verification: Employing robust identification processes, such as verifying users' identities through verification or biometric data, can help reduce the likelihood of fraudulent use to the app.

c) In-app safety features: Both Uber and Lyft have implemented security measures, such as panic buttons, live location tracking, and mutual rating systems, to enhance responsibility and enable swift responses to potential incidents.

d) Education and training: Providing thorough training programs to drivers and passengers, including awareness of potential risks, managing conflicts effectively, and reporting procedures, is vital. Active Law Enforcement Involvement:

Law enforcement authorities play a critical part in addressing sexual assault and violence within the ride-hailing industry. They should work closely together with ride-hailing companies to develop efficient approaches to tackle and respond to such crimes. Some key steps for law enforcement agencies include:

a) uber rape Enhanced reporting mechanisms: Establishing streamlined reporting channels and ensuring privacy for those affected can encourage more reporting and facilitate enforcement efforts.

b) Partnerships and information exchange: Sharing relevant information between police and ride-hailing providers can assist in identifying repeat offenders and improving preventive measures.

c) Training and education: Conducting educational workshops for law enforcement personnel to gain insight into the unique challenges of sexual assault and violence in the ride-hailing sector can enhance their capacity to respond effectively.
